Siding replacement services involve removing existing exterior siding and installing new panels to improve the appearance and functionality of a property’s exterior. This process typically includes assessing the condition of the current siding, removing damaged or outdated materials, and carefully installing new siding that enhances curb appeal and provides additional protection against the elements. The work may also involve repairing underlying structures or insulation to ensure the new siding performs optimally and maintains the structural integrity of the building.
One of the primary reasons homeowners and property owners seek siding replacement is to address issues caused by aging, weather damage, or improper installation of previous siding. Over time, siding can develop cracks, warping, rot, or mold, which can compromise the building’s exterior and lead to further structural problems. Replacing worn or damaged siding can help prevent water infiltration, reduce energy costs by improving insulation, and eliminate unsightly appearance caused by discoloration or de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Harvard,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Average Cost Range - Siding replacement costs typically fall between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the size of the project and material choices. For example, replacing siding on a standard 1,500-square-foot home might cost around $8,000 to $12,000. Costs can vary based on local labor rates and material preferences.
Material Expenses - The type of siding material significantly influences overall costs. Vinyl siding may cost between $3 and $7 per square foot, while fiber cement options can range from $6 to $12 per square foot. Higher-end materials like wood or specialty siding tend to be more expensive.
Labor and Installation - Labor costs for siding replacement generally range from $2,000 to $5,000, depending on project complexity and local rates. Professional installation is essential for ensuring proper fit and durability of the new siding.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include removing old siding, which can add $1,000 to $3,000, and repairs to the underlying structure. These costs vary based on the condition of the existing exterior and any unforeseen issues encountered during installation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
